Slovak Interior Minister Ferenčák Suffers Mild Concussion After Physical Attack

Slovak Interior Minister Matúš Šutaj Eštok confirmed that his deputy, František Ferenčák, suffered a mild concussion after being struck in the face during a recent incident. The attack on Ferenčák, who serves as deputy interior minister, resulted in medical treatment for brain trauma. Šutaj Eštok stated that Ferenčák did not mention the incident before his scheduled questioning and did not dispute the political motivation behind the attack. The Interior Ministry, which oversees domestic security and law enforcement in Slovakia, has not provided additional details about the circumstances of the assault or potential suspects.
